here's what i got for you from my recent road trip across the country with a good friend of mine, paw. well, not exactly across the country cuz it starts in las vegas, nv and ends in new orleans, la. along the way we stopped in at least 12 points of interest, including hoover dam (nevada-arizona), grand canyon (arizona), red rock canyon - sedona (arizona), antelope canyon (arizona), monument valley (utah), arches national park (utah), rockies (colorado), valley of fires (new mexico), white sands (new mexico), el paso (texas), the alamo - san antonio (texas), houston (texas), new orleans (louisiana).

the trip was just magnificently grand. i was so in awe with the view i saw, the great creation of the higher being that makes you small. and it was definitely the most remembered trip i've ever had.. i just wish it never ends.

the above picture is taken along the route 163 in utah in view of the long road from the monument valley, as we continue our way to arches national park, driving 4 hours north from monument valley. we stopped as we saw the silhouette of the monument valley and the straight line of the route we have passed by. magnificent!
